Definition of "Buckinghamshire"

Buckinghamshire

/ˈbʌk.ɪŋ.əm.ʃə(ɹ)/
  • proper noun

    1. An inland county of England bounded by Northamptonshire, Bedfordshire, Hertfordshire, Greater London, Berkshire and Oxfordshire.  

    2. Buckinghamshire Council, a local government unitary authority which replaced the county council in 2020 in all of Buckinghamshire except Milton Keynes.
